FL57 CNJ is a 2007 Honda Cb 900 F-5 in Silver with a 919c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 90.9%.

Across all 2007 Honda Cb 900 F-5 models, the average MOT pass rate is 86.6% with a typical mileage of 14,262 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Honda Cb 900 F-5 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th is below minimum requirements of 1.0mm, accounting for 18 recorded failures. If you're considering buying FL57 CNJ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Honda Cb 900 F-5 typically stays on UK roads for around 21 years. At 19 years old, this Honda Cb 900 F-5 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
